Default Grundig Classic 960 - review

For serious shortwave listening, get a digitally tuned receiver, this
one s analog. AM and FM work very well on this radio, with top-notch
sound. It's a very good-looking unit, and will compliment any room in
the house. There are jacks for external antennas, AM, FM, and Shortwave.
There is an input jack feature, for CD players and such. This acts as an
excellent amplifier. For instance, if you have a well-operating
portable receiver, with poor quality sound, hook it to this thing, and
BINGO. I paid $90.00, new in the box.
